Parthenon Fabrics in Panama City sells to the public at below wholesale prices. Thursday mornings are best time to go, as they put out the new bolts for the week. It's been a while since I went there so you should probably call to check their hours and see if Thursdays are still good.
They often have Sunbrella type fabrics, upholstery fabrics, curtain fabrics all for fraction of what you'd pay elsewhere. Some of them are seconds, so you have to watch as they measure out your fabric and look for any obvious flaws (just buy a little extra if there's a flaw, still way cheaper than other sources).
